Snapshot

PostSyncer is strongest when your workflow values consistency and speed over advanced governance complexity.

Typical win pattern

  • clear content pillar
  • repeatable formatting templates
  • predictable scheduling cadence

Typical failure pattern

Teams adopt too many channels too early and dilute quality control.

5-Minute Action Plan

  1. Run one 7-day publishing sprint with fixed content templates.
  2. Check scheduling reliability on your top two channels.
  3. Compare quality of engagement, not only posting frequency.
  4. Document what still requires manual work.
  5. Decide upgrade based on time saved per week.
